In a cafeteria, 3/10 of the students ate eating salads, and 3/5 are eating sandwiches. There are 30 students in the cafeteria. H

ow many students are eating lunches other than salads or sandwiches?
Mathematics
1 answer:
Daniel [21]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:

1/10 or 3kids

Step-by-step explanation:

First you want to take 3/5 into 10nths so you do 3/5 times two and you get 6/10 then you add up 6/10 and 3/10 and you get 9/10. 30÷ 9/10 is 27 so 3 kids are having other things

Ashley deposits $1000 into an account that earns 4% interest compounded 2 times per year. how much money will Ashley have in her
loris [4]
The equation for compound interest is A=P(1+\frac{r}{n})^{nt}, where:
P is the original deposit (or "principal")
r is the rate of the interest (in decimal form)
n is the number of times per year that the interest is compounded
t is the time passed in years

Plugging in your values, we see that the equation becomes A=1000(1+\frac{.04}{2})^{(2)(5)}=1000(1.02)^{10}

which equals, to the nearest cent, $1218.99, which is answer C.

Brandee makes an hourly wage. In the last pay period, she earned $800 for regular hours and $240 for overtime hours. Her overtim
abruzzese [7]

Answer:

  h = 13.333 +693.333/r

Step-by-step explanation:

For h hours, Brandee's pay will be ...

  pay = 40r +(h -40)(1.5r) . . . . 40 hours at rate r + overtime (h-40) hours at 1.5r

  pay = 40r +1.5hr -60r . . . . . eliminate parentheses

  pay = 1.5hr -20r . . . . . . . . . . collect terms

Solving for h, we have ...

  pay +20r = 1.5hr . . . . . . . . . . add 20r

  h = (pay +20r)/(1.5r) . . . . . . . . divide by 1.5r

For the given pay of 800 +240 = 1040, we have ...

  h = (1040 +20r)/(1.5r)

  h = 13.333 +693.333/r . . . . . simplify to 2 terms

_____

<em>Additional comments</em>

You need to know r to find the number of hours Brandee worked. She got paid $800 for a presumed 40-hours of regular time, so made r = $20 per hour. The above formula will tell you she worked 48 hours in the pay period.
